#ca7c94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ca7c94 is composed of 79.2% red, 48.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 341.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 63.9%. #ca7c94 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#950029.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#ca7c94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ca7c94 has RGB values of R:202, G:124,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.27,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13270164.

Shades and Tints of #ca7c94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090405 is the darkest color, while #fdf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ca7c94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a79fa2 is the less saturated color, while #fc4a81 is the most saturated one.
